## Deployment

The Lockmere reset-flow service deploys via the Hargate pipeline, blue-green, no manual steps. Tokens are single-use, short-lived, and bound to the requesting session. Rate limiting applies per account and per source. Email dispatch goes through the internal Postfall relay only; no third-party senders. All secrets come from the vault at deploy time and never land on disk. Audit logging is mandatory and cannot be disabled via flags. The service boots with the configuration values below.

service settings:
quenath:
  log_level: info
  metrics_host: metrics.quenath.tolvaqlabs.internal
  pin: 1407
  pool_size: 8

### Action Item: Spoolhaven Retry Storm

From last Tuesday's outage: the Spoolhaven print service retried failed jobs without backoff, saturating the render pool. Fix merged; retries now use capped exponential backoff with jitter. Owner will monitor for a week before closing. The agreed retry constants are recorded below.

constants for yadup-kajof:
RATE_LIMITS = {
    "zorwyn": 1,
    "druwyn": 1,
}

Migration step 4: swap the legacy ScanBridge client for the new Quagmire barcode SDK. Remove the polling loop in ScannerPoller.java; the SDK pushes decode events directly. Verify the checksum mode matches warehouse hardware at the Delverton site before merging. Reviewer: confirm no references to the old endpoint remain. The service reads the following values at startup.

deployment values, kajep-kageg:
[praix]
host = praix.paliqcorp.corp
user = praix_svc
database = praix_prod

## Build Provenance: Health Checks Behind the Brackenford LB

Welcome aboard! Quick primer: every instance behind the Brackenford load balancer serves a health endpoint, and that endpoint also reports which build it's running. This matters because the LB happily mixes old and new instances mid-rollout, and you'll want to know exactly what answered your request. When debugging, always grab the provenance line from the health response rather than guessing from deploy logs. A healthy response ends with the build token shown below.

pipeline stamp: htk9_6ce9d33c5